Marin County’s Seventh “Project Homeless Connect” will be hosted by the Town of Fairfax on  Thursday, February 18, at the Fairfax Women’s Club, 46 Park Road,  between 10:00 a.m. and 2:00 p.m.  This is a multifaceted event that gives some of the neediest in our community a chance to access services they need and at the same time shines a light on an issue that remains largely misunderstood in Marin County. The event will provide food, health testing, a dentist, counseling, ID cards, lunch and a whole lot of hope.

 

Modeled after San Francisco’s Project Homeless Connect – now a national model – this event has been developed under the auspices of the Marin County Board of Supervisors and the Town of Fairfax. Participating agencies include Marin County Department of Health and Human Services, St. Vincent de Paul Society, Homeward Bound, Community Action Marin, Legal Aid of Marin, Ritter Center, Center for Volunteer and Nonprofit Leadership, , Warm Wishes, the Fairfax Police Department,  The Town of San Anselmo, The San Anselmo Police Department, United Way of the Bay Area and MarinLink, which has taken the lead on organizing this event.

 

 “The programs and services already exist, Project Homeless Connect offers us a way to reach out to those who don’t know about them or know how to access them”, said Supervisor Susan Adams
